A. Monerris is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Atmospheric Science and Aerospace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, A. Monerris has authored 37 papers receiving a total of 842 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 37 papers in Environmental Engineering, 33 papers in Atmospheric Science and 19 papers in Aerospace Engineering. Recurrent topics in A. Monerris’s work include Soil Moisture and Remote Sensing (37 papers), Precipitation Measurement and Analysis (28 papers) and Synthetic Aperture Radar (SAR) Applications and Techniques (15 papers). A. Monerris is often cited by papers focused on Soil Moisture and Remote Sensing (37 papers), Precipitation Measurement and Analysis (28 papers) and Synthetic Aperture Radar (SAR) Applications and Techniques (15 papers). A. Monerris collaborates with scholars based in Spain, Australia and United States. A. Monerris's co-authors include Jeffrey P. Walker, Adriano Camps, Christoph Rüdiger, Thomas J. Jackson, Ying Gao, M. Vall‐llossera, Dongryeol Ryu, Xiaoling Wu, R. Onrubia and Hyuk Park and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res, Water Resources Research and Journal of Hydrology.
